Profile Followers or Playlist Followers: Knowing Which You Need
This is the first thing to get right, because Spotify has two very different kinds of followers. Profile followers follow your artist account, so they are tied to you and get your releases surfaced to them. Playlist followers follow a specific playlist you run, which grows that playlist's reach and can turn it into a promotional asset of its own.
Which one you want depends on your goal. An artist building a career wants profile followers, the audience that carries from one release to the next. A curator growing a playlist wants playlist followers, since a larger playlist attracts submissions and pulls in more listeners. How Your Follower Count Feeds the Spotify Algorithm
Spotify's discovery engine leans on signals of genuine interest, and followers are one of the clearest. When your profile has a healthy following, the platform is more inclined to surface your tracks in algorithmic placements like Discover Weekly, Radio, and related-artist suggestions, because a followed artist reads as one listeners actually want to hear.
That is the compounding effect. A stronger follower base helps your music reach more algorithmic listeners, and some of those listeners follow you too, which feeds the next release. Why Every Follower Is a Head Start on Your Next Release
Here is the payoff that makes followers different from plays. The day you drop a track, your followers can be notified through Release Radar and their following feed, so you start with listeners already lined up instead of an empty count. That early wave of streams in the first hours is exactly what the algorithm watches to decide whether a track deserves wider placement.
